3. Key Technical Specifications

Parameter Value
Total Memory 192K
User MegaBasic Memory 47K
Supported Protocols Modbus RTU, GE Fanuc CCM
Programming Languages MegaBasic, C
Serial Ports 2 (accessed via single 25-pin D-shell connector)
Port Connector 25-pin D-shell (Ports 1 & 2 combined)
Backplane Current 425 mA @ +5 VDC
Battery Backup Lithium battery (IC693ACC301 replacement)
LED Indicators OK, US1, US2 (plus BD OK / P1 OK / P2 OK on some views)
Restart Front-panel Restart pushbutton
Mounting Location CPU baseplate only (any slot except CPU slot 1)
Incompatible With Embedded CPUs (311/313/323), expansion or remote racks
Compatible Cables IC693CBL304/305 (Wye), IC690CBL701/702/705

4. Product Introduction

The GE Fanuc IC693PCM301 is a Programmable Coprocessor Module for Series 90-30 modular CPUs. It adds independent processing power and dual serial communications to the PLC, supporting Modbus RTU and GE Fanuc CCM protocols. The module carries 192K of total memory with 47K available for MegaBasic programs and can also run C applications.

Both serial ports are brought out through a single 25-pin D-shell connector on the front panel. Typical uses include interfacing with programming terminals, CRTs, barcode readers, scales, printers, ASCII devices, and RTU master equipment. The module must be installed in the main CPU baseplate (any slot except the CPU itself) and will not operate in expansion or remote racks or with embedded CPU models 311/313/323.

5. Troubleshooting Quick Reference

Symptom Possible Cause Relevance to this Part Quick Check Method Recommendation
OK LED off Module not powered or fatal fault ✅ High Measure +5 VDC on backplane; reseat module Verify power supply and slot contact; press Restart
US1 / US2 LEDs never flash No serial activity or cable problem ✅ High Check cable continuity and pinout; monitor port with terminal program Confirm correct Wye or dual-port cable and baud settings
Program lost after power cycle Dead backup battery ✅ High Measure battery voltage; replace if low Install fresh IC693ACC301 battery and restore program
Module will not initialize Wrong baseplate or incompatible CPU ✅ High Confirm installation is in main CPU rack only, not expansion/remote Move to CPU baseplate; verify CPU is modular type (not 311/313/323)
Communication errors on both ports Shared connector or ground loop ✅ Medium Test each port independently with known-good cable Use proper Wye cable; check shield grounding
Restart button has no effect Module hung or hardware failure ✅ Medium Power-cycle the rack and retry If still unresponsive, replace module

If the module continues to fail after these checks, photograph the faceplate LEDs, note the exact cable used, and capture any diagnostic messages before contacting technical support.

6. Frequently Asked Questions (FAQ)

Q: Is the IC693PCM301 still manufactured? A: No. The Series 90-30 platform is mature. Available units are New Surplus or tested refurbished stock. Keep spares if the system relies on the PCM for critical communications or custom code.

Q: Where can I install this module? A: Only in the main CPU baseplate, any slot except the CPU slot itself (slot 1). It will not operate in expansion or remote racks and is incompatible with embedded CPUs (311, 313, 323).

Q: How much user memory is available? A: Total memory is 192K; approximately 47K is available for MegaBasic programs. The higher-memory IC693PCM311 offers 640K total / 190K MegaBasic if more space is required.

Q: What protocols and languages does it support? A: Modbus RTU and GE Fanuc CCM for communications. Application code can be written in MegaBasic or C. A free RTU Master example program was historically available from GE Fanuc.

Q: How are the two serial ports accessed? A: Both ports share a single 25-pin D-shell connector on the front of the module. A Wye cable (IC693CBL304/305 or equivalent) is required to break the connector out into two separate ports.

Q: Does the battery need to be connected? A: Yes, if you need to retain the RAM-based program across power cycles. The lithium battery (IC693ACC301) mounts on the inside of the faceplate. Disconnect it for long-term storage to avoid deep discharge.

Q: Can this module be hot-swapped? A: No. Power down the rack before inserting or removing the module. Hot-swapping risks damage to the backplane and the PCM.
